Dec. 2005 A note on the nonrelativistic limit of Dirac operators and spectral concentration
Hiroshi T. Ito, Osanobu Yamada
Proc. Japan Acad. Ser. A Math. Sci. 81(10): 157-161 (Dec. 2005). DOI: 10.3792/pjaa.81.157

Abstract

We study the nonrelativistic limit of Dirac operators from the viewpoint of the spectral relationship between Dirac operators and Pauli operators. We show that Dirac operators have spectral concentration about eigenvalues of Pauli operators for a large class of magnetic fields and electric potentials diverging at infinity.
